What Exactly is a Camera? ๐ธ
A camera is a versatile device primarily designed for taking still photographs. Whether youโre a professional photographer or an amateur snapping pics on your phone, cameras come in various forms, from DSLRs and mirrorless cameras to compact point-and-shoots. ๐ทโจ
Cameras excel at capturing high-resolution images with excellent detail and color accuracy. They offer a wide range of settings and manual controls, allowing you to fine-tune every aspect of your shot. Plus, the ability to swap lenses opens up endless creative possibilities. ๐๐จ
And What About a Camcorder? ๐ฅ
A camcorder, on the other hand, is specifically designed for recording videos. While modern cameras can also shoot video, camcorders are built to handle extended recording sessions and provide smooth, stable footage. ๐ฌ๐
Camcorders often come with features like image stabilization, built-in microphones, and longer battery life, making them ideal for videographers and content creators. They also typically have dedicated buttons and controls for video functions, ensuring a seamless shooting experience. ๐ค๐
Key Differences: Camera vs. Camcorder ๐
1. Purpose: Cameras focus on still photography, while camcorders are all about video. ๐ธ๐ฅ
2. Features: Cameras offer advanced settings for photography, such as aperture and shutter speed control. Camcorders, however, prioritize video-specific features like autofocus during recording and wind noise reduction. ๐ ๏ธ๐ง
3. Design: Cameras are generally more compact and portable, making them easy to carry around. Camcorders are bulkier but designed for stability and comfort during long shoots. ๐๏ธ๐ฅ
4. Battery Life: Camcorders usually have longer battery life, crucial for extended video sessions. Cameras, especially high-end models, may require frequent battery changes when used for video. โก๐
Choosing the Right Tool for Your Creative Journey ๐
Deciding between a camera and a camcorder ultimately depends on your creative goals. If youโre passionate about photography and love capturing moments in still images, a camera is your best bet. ๐ธ๐
If youโre more into videography and want to produce high-quality videos, a camcorder will serve you well. Whether youโre documenting family events, creating YouTube content, or producing professional videos, a camcorder offers the tools you need. ๐ฅ๐ป
Of course, many modern cameras can handle both photography and videography, offering a hybrid solution. If youโre looking for versatility, consider a high-end mirrorless camera or a DSLR with robust video capabilities. ๐ธ๐ฅโจ
